Next.js 12 is a Beast
Вставка
- Опубліковано 10 чер 2024
- Your first look at Next.js version 12. It's packed with awesome new features, like a rust compiler, middleware, concurrent mode, server components, and more. Full course fireship.io/courses/react-nex...
#js #react #firstlook
🔗 Resources
Announcement nextjs.org/blog/next-12
Full Course fireship.io/courses/react-nex...
📚 Chapters
00:00 Next.js 12
46:00 Middleware
02:42 Suspense Support
03:16 Server Components
04:41 URL Imports
🔥 Get More Content - Upgrade to PRO
Upgrade to Fireship PRO at fireship.io/pro
Use code lORhwXd2 for 25% off your first payment.
🎨 My Editor Settings
- Atom One Dark
- vscode-icons
- Fira Code Font
🔖 Topics Covered
- Next.js 12 new features
- Rust compiler in Next.js
- Using suspense with Next.js
- React Server Components SSR - Наука та технологія
Literally this was announced 24 hours ago and Jeff's already made this video, updated his Next course, while looking after a child you can hear in the background. What a guy
haha think beta was out a bit more time eh? :)
I had to pause the video to check if that's my baby crying 😁
@@aleks6331 hahaha same 😂😂
When child?
@@neillunavat 3:11
Yes! Make a series of how you redo your website with Next 12!! That would be wholesome!
waiting for it
up
Using this comment like button for yes
yup we need that
YESSS
Definitely make that a series!
I'll pre-order the popcorn and dim the lights in advance!
Totally agree, would be really nice to see a full site being built with nextjs
Yes please! Would love that series
omg yes!, this changes all strategy auth for pages in nextjs, of course with typescript 🙏
Yo yo yo that’s my bro
Would really love that
"X is now built in rust and got YYY% faster thanks to it!"
As a rust developer, it never stops being satisfying to hear that.
Holding off learning rust atm, got way too much stuff going on. I do look forward for when I do it though!
Omg same though. Everything I’ve rewritten in Rust is literally entire orders of magnitude faster than the original language. Granted, usually the language is either swift or TypeScript, but man is it nice.
I learned rust as one of my first main languages. Too bad that every job position for rust wants a senior with several years' experience. I had to go back to other stacks just for a chance of being employed lol.
Just wish there was a larger community/better support for scientific computation & ML. Maybe one day 🤞
It amazes me how you have this skill to know what's in most of our minds and make a video out of it, I swear :P
Singularity is near... 😂
I was a few days away from starting a huge next js project
I just recently started my first next.js project and was reading through the documentation today. I saw the chapters for middleware and html streaming and had no clue what it was about. And boom jeff makes a video about it
that shit just came out man, he made a vid as soon as it came out like .. wdym read our minds >.
A Fireship redesign series with NextJs 12 would be awesome.
The next person who makes a pun gets banned (no pun intended)
Hope the next person is already banned.
Waiting to vue how people react to this.
Can i make Buns 😂
I mean.. that’s one way to react
Can we have that Angulered tech again?
This is some next level stuff
To anwser the question: yes a next.js series would be really nice
Next.js level
Pun intended
@@victoravr10 you beat me to it
Really looking forward to a full course on this!
This conference just happened yesterday and there’s already a Fireship video 🔥 crazy impressive Jeff
I was watching the conference yesterday. Needed someone to clear things up for me, this was very helpful thanks!
Loved the breakdown of all the new features in Next! I started updating some of my own projects and have been blown away by the Rust compiler's performance.
I also loved the gymnastics clips. I was a gymnast and the whole time I was watching this, I was like "hey I know that guy!"
Definitely waiting for the full redesign series.
It'll be a joy to watch
hell yeah I want the full series!! I was sold when Server Components was explained, I'm thinking of using Next js with my latest MVP and this would be the best time to get a series from you on the same topic! God bless you Jeff
I wonder how hard Vercel made it to use Server Components outside of their platform. I'd 100% switch back to React. Just the Rust compiler itself should bring an orgasmic experience.
The compiler for me is just crazy! I'm very exited to use this with React 18 and Recoil.js. Please make the series, it will be the best thing in the world!
Those series would be amazing to have! Thank you so much for your hard work!
Yes please! Making it a series would be incredibly incredible
I want to see a Next video on this topic! Definitely up for the series
you learn (by yourself) and teach faster then the speed of light
how can you make videos with so much content with such a great speed?? amazing!
Definitely would like to watch the series of you upgrading your site. 👍
Love your videos. ❤️❤️❤️
Next is a wonderfully simple core idea taken to such extremes. Reminds me of how React was simple and straightforward once, too. The cycle never ends.
I just started learning next js and definitely a rebuild of a complete website would be the best thing to happen.
Looking forward to your full course on this! cant await
Hi there! Undoubtedly your content is one of a kind & most of the time I keep on checking the playback speed subconciously lest I miss something important in the seamless realm of grasping the technical nickels and dimes. I am grateful for the efforts you make and impart the knowledge to others in such a unique and high quality format. I would definitely love to experience the pro-level stuff with what you plan to do w/your website using the latest #next.js concepts!! Thanks, love, and respect!!
Hell yeah we want to see the full redesign of the fireship site in NextJS 12 as a series here! Pleaaase!
I will absolutely buy your course after seeing this!
Yup, me too
I'm looking forward to watching the next video of this series!!! Great :D
Your channel is hands down the best JS resource I have ever come across. Mad props.
Please make the series happen, it will be a learning opportunity for lot of us here.
Boring subjects become interesting with fireship's incredible visuals and the funny GIFs. Agree?
How would we know? He's not talking about boring subjects
Why is this boring to you? I think the topic itself is super cool. :D
@Zelená Žaba Amazing input. Is there a reason for this?
Yes, the production is good but if you need pretty pictures and GIFs to cope with these topics, you are in the wrong business.
The only news channel, that I love.
Thanks!
The rebuild series sounds amazing,
thank you for the awesome video
Waiting for your Next series 😉
Didn't expect to be this fast to your Next video.
Wonderful! looking forward to watch these series...
We absolutely need that series!
Holy shit, this is the good stuff, I’m not even a JS guy but damn, nice
Come my child, I want to convert you.
@@AtomicCodeX convert me I m new to js and wanna learn everything he said in the video
@@shreyaan start with jQuery and stop on midway and jump to React JS
Governments should ban react and vue.
@@Isaac_Flat_Earth you must be the angular guy
Dang, this is really, *really* the next level of JS frameworks.
I was watching the conf yesterday & hoping that you'll do a video on it for us to understand better what's new ! Thank you !!
This just makes me want to learn advanced webdev immediately 😔 but all good things must not be rushed
Take your time, you'll enjoy it more
I've used both Next.js and Svelte. The latter make more sense to me as it's native HTML and js.
can't we use them both at the same time?
Yes! For series on Next.js here.
And thanks for your content!
Yes please that would be great having that series your courses are great by the way
I'm not a nuxt master but things like middleware were there long time since. And nuxt3 that are in actual public beta has suspense and vite for rapid development and it was announced while ago, I don't know about server components but other things was like .. hey.. I've seen it in nuxt already.
Kinda disappointed.
That's what I felt too
same too. nuxt and bro.
also, serverless nuxt basically achieves the same thing.
@@papajohnsuk5965 agree, I was thinking that react leads here. Was wrong
So they basically added features Nuxt already had years ago?
hmm like?
Noice! The event was great and really surprized me. Can't wait to put this features in production
Super clear, efficient and helpful video. Jeff, you are a legend!
The way he laughed at himself after saying “see you in the nExT one” 🤣
i took that passive aggressively tbh
@@oogabooga2581 you shouldn’t think so negative. The dude is funny and knows it what’s wrong with that
@@oogabooga2581 that’s a killer name you got tho. 10/10 approval rating
@@rafaelzasas9421 ?
Anyone else feel like the JS framework world is moving too fast to keep up?
Please make the series. I am really looking forward to it, so I can both learn the new features and work with Next.js as well
Always waiting for your videos, awesome , keep it up ❤️
It makes me laugh how all these frameworks are just trying to re-discover having everything server side. Welcome to 20 years ago guys.
Here we go. Another Framework a dev has to learn, adding to his 48 other languages and frameworks he already has to keep track of to be attractive on the jobs market. Do I need to say more...
And all just to build the same old HTML based CRUD apps (with a lot of extra steps)
Please do the series, I would gladly watch it. you got me hyped :)
Definitely make this UA-cam series!! Thank you for your excellent contents
Sveltekit has almost instant recompile times. The streaming components is nice but I’m sure it’s doable in svelte as that’s just protocol features. Besides, React is trash and Facebook’s dirty hands are all over it. Angular is still better than react and you know it!
Nice stuff. I could not make time to watch the nextjs conference yesterday. I hope I can find the conference video here on UA-cam. Thanks for the video Fireship🔥
Love it! Go for it regarding the series!
That's exciting stuff! Definitely going to play with Next 12.
Love this! Also ... would love if you made a recoil course, it truly seems to be the future of state management.
We would like those series for sure!
Definitely make that a series!
I am looking forward to it
100% make that a series, would love to see it!
looking forward for those series !
Yeah! Make that a series please! It looks awesome
Thanks a lot for timely update.
Yes, a series like that would be nice to see
Series idea is awasome :D
Without a second thought, I'll become a pro member if your make that series. I bought the nextJS firebase course and it was amazing, but this would take the cake.
Yup up for your redesign series. ❤️❤️
Yes, please make rebuilding your website into a series. I would love to find out more about Next.js!
Yes a series is needed 👍😊
Thanks Jeff, really looking forward to the Fireship redesign series
That series on the site redesign would be siiiiiiick. Thanks for another great video!
Definitely make that a series!
Yes would love to see a full series
I was looking for nest js videos on your page. Came across next js 12 updates and Wow... i just got an idea to restrict access to other pages for authentication using middleware. No need to google or stackoverflow... XD.. It was a great coincidence. My app using nest js and next js. Thanks man.
YES I would like to see that as a series on your channel!
Just saw this today, Thanks for the video, pls make that a series.
Definitely want to see that series!!
I'd love to see the series on rebuilding Fireship into Nextjs!
Definitely a series on UA-cam!! Go Next 12!!
Looking forwards to the series! :)
Would definitely watch the course
Would love a series!
Yesss!
Please make that series
Yes, please make that course!
Love this dudes videos, how does he talk so clear and fast?! 🙌🏼😁 also React + Firebase = 🖤
Wow, I watched this a week ago and didn't know a thing about what Next was, so this video didn't mean anything to me. Now by chance I got an introduction to Next through a UA-cam recommendation and later came back to this video. This looks absolutely amazing...
yes please on that series!! that and this sound amazing.
Would love to see the Next series!
Yes, definitely make that a series!
Yes! Make a series of how you redo your website with Next 12!!
Absolutely demo next, would love to see it
love the music in the intro 😍
Would love to see a series on that!
Yes would like to see you use the new nextjs features to update your site
That would be a really cool series!! I’d watch it
Yes, a Next Js video would be awesome 🔥
Love your content mate